M743 XTC is a 1994 MG RV8 in Green with a 3,940c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68%.
Across all 1994 MG RV8 models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.0% with a typical mileage of 25,309 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a MG RV8 fails its MOT is steering rack gaiter split, accounting for 153 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M743 XTC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G RV8 typ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 32 years old, this MG RV8 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
